Как проверить два файла excel на идентичность


Microsoft Excel — одно из самых популярных приложений для работы с таблицами. В процессе работы с этой программой, возникает необходимость сравнения двух файлов Excel на их идентичность. Это может быть полезно, когда вы делаете изменения в документе и хотите убедиться, что ничего не пропустили или не случилось непредвиденной ошибки.

Существует несколько способов сравнить два файла Excel на их идентичность. Один из простых способов — использовать функцию сравнения встроенную в Excel. Она позволяет быстро и легко сравнить два файла отображая различия между ними.

Шаг 1: Откройте оба файла, которые вы хотите сравнить, в Excel. Шаг 2: Выберите вкладку «Ревизия» на фронтальной панели. Шаг 3: В разделе «Сравнение», выберите «Сравнить и объединить рабочие книги». Шаг 4: Выберите два файла для сравнения и нажмите «Сравнить».

Другой способ позволяет сравнивать файлы Excel используя онлайн-инструменты, такие как «DiffChecker» или «Comparisimo». Вам нужно загрузить оба файла в инструмент, и он автоматически отобразит различия между ними.

В-третьих, вы также можете использовать специализированные программы для сравнения файлов, такие как «Beyond Compare» или «WinMerge». Эти утилиты позволяют не только сравнивать два файла Excel, но и проводить сравнение идентичности в других форматах.

Сравнение двух файлов Excel на идентичность может быть полезной и необходимой задачей в вашей работе. Используя один из этих способов, вы сможете быстро и легко выявить различия между файлами и убедиться, что ничего не пропущено. Не откладывайте эту задачу на потом, проверьте свои файлы Excel сейчас!

Метод сравнения двух excel-файлов

Чтобы воспользоваться этой функцией, откройте один из файлов, затем выберите вкладку «Ревизия» и нажмите на кнопку «Сравнить и объединить». В открывшемся окне выберите второй файл, который вы хотите сравнить, и нажмите «OK». Excel автоматически сравнит два файла и покажет различия между ними. Вы можете просмотреть сравнение в виде отчета и внести необходимые изменения в файлы.

Если вам нужно сравнить файлы программно, вы можете воспользоваться языком программирования, таким как Python. В экосистеме Python есть несколько пакетов, которые позволяют работать с excel-файлами и сравнивать их. Например, пакеты pandas и openpyxl предоставляют функции для чтения excel-файлов и сравнения их содержимого.

С помощью пакета pandas вы можете прочитать содержимое двух файлов в два отдельных объекта DataFrame и затем сравнить их с помощью функции equals:

import pandas as pddf1 = pd.read_excel('file1.xlsx')df2 = pd.read_excel('file2.xlsx')if df1.equals(df2):print("Файлы идентичны")else:print("Файлы отличаются")

Если вы хотите сравнить только определенные столбцы или строки, вы можете использовать срезы данных перед сравнением:

import pandas as pddf1 = pd.read_excel('file1.xlsx', usecols='A:C', nrows=100)df2 = pd.read_excel('file2.xlsx', usecols='A:C', nrows=100)if df1.equals(df2):print("Файлы идентичны")else:print("Файлы отличаются")

Используя пакет openpyxl, вы можете пройти по каждой ячейке в двух файлах и сравнить их значения:

from openpyxl import load_workbookwb1 = load_workbook('file1.xlsx')wb2 = load_workbook('file2.xlsx')ws1 = wb1.activews2 = wb2.activeidentical = Truefor row in range(1, ws1.max_row + 1):for column in range(1, ws1.max_column + 1):cell1 = ws1.cell(row=row, column=column)cell2 = ws2.cell(row=row, column=column)if cell1.value != cell2.value:identical = Falsebreakif identical:print("Файлы идентичны")else:print("Файлы отличаются")

Эти примеры помогут вам начать сравнивать excel-файлы и находить их различия. Вы можете дополнить их в зависимости от ваших потребностей и уникальных требований.

Программы для сравнения excel-файлов

Существует несколько программ, которые позволяют сравнить два файла Excel на их идентичность:

Название программыОписание
WinMergeWinMerge — бесплатная программа, позволяющая сравнить и объединить текстовые и бинарные файлы. Она также поддерживает сравнение исходного кода, изображений и других типов файлов. Для сравнения Excel-файлов необходимо предварительно преобразовать их в текстовый формат.
Beyond CompareBeyond Compare — это платная программа, которая предлагает широкие возможности для сравнения и сопоставления файлов и папок. Она поддерживает сравнение Excel-файлов, а также множество других типов файлов. Программа предоставляет детальную информацию о различиях между файлами, позволяет объединять измененные участки и многое другое.
XLComparatorXLComparator — это специализированная программа для сравнения Excel-файлов. Она позволяет выявлять различия между файлами на основе различий в ячейках, формулах, комментариях, стилях и т. д. Программа позволяет просматривать детальную информацию о различиях и визуально помечать их на рабочем листе.

Выбор программы зависит от ваших потребностей и предпочтений. Бесплатные программы, такие как WinMerge, могут быть достаточными для простого сравнения текстовых данных в Excel-файлах. Если вам нужны расширенные возможности, такие как сравнение формул или объединение изменений, платные программы, такие как Beyond Compare или XLComparator, могут быть более подходящими.

Добавить комментарий

Вам также может понравиться